tipWhen applying for a visa for a summer program lasting one month with an invitation letter from a university, determine the correct visa category.
It is crucial to differentiate between a 'visit' visa and a tourist visa. Consult the official visa application center (e.g., VFS) website for precise definitions and requirements for each visa type to ensure you apply for the appropriate one.

riskStrategies involving "birth tourism" to obtain citizenship in countries like Argentina and Brazil have been discussed, with Argentina notably tightening its regulations.
Uruguay offers a pathway to citizenship for families within 3-4 years, but caveats exist, such as potential issues with non-naturalized passports during international travel and risks of revocation for prolonged absence from the country. In Paraguay, obtaining a residency permit (VNJ) is straightforward, but acquiring citizenship and a passport is considerably more complex and uncertain. Passport revocation for extended non-residency is also a concern in countries like Uruguay and Mexico.

tipFor international couples (e.g., Russian and German citizens), marrying in Russia involves a 21-day waiting period and requires original documents and personal presence of both parties for the application.
Easier and faster alternatives for marriage abroad include Cyprus, Denmark, and Georgia. Georgia is a particularly good option for couples where one party does not have a Schengen visa, as it is often visa-free for citizens of both Russia and Germany, and procedures are typically streamlined.

how-toTo remotely deregister from Russian military accounting (военкомат) while residing abroad, it is possible to use a notarized power of attorney (доверенность).
The authorized person (e.g., a family member) can visit the military commissariat with the power of attorney, a copy of the university enrollment document (if applicable, with Russian translation), and a written statement requesting deregistration. The specific requirements and success rate vary significantly depending on the individual military commissariat; some are more accommodating, while others (especially in major cities like Moscow and St. Petersburg or certain regions like Moscow Oblast) may demand additional documents such as consular certificates confirming employment or requiring only consular-certified translations of all foreign documents. It's important to prepare for potential bureaucratic hurdles and differing requirements.

ruleObtaining visas and legalizing status in countries like the US and Europe presents challenges for Russian citizens.
Visa appointment wait times can be extensive (e.g., a year for US interviews). While European immigration is also complex, solutions and pathways exist for those willing to navigate the process. Overall, relocation often involves significant bureaucratic hurdles.

caseFor birth tourism, Chile offers visa-free access to the USA for the child, but parents may need simplified temporary residency (VNJ).
In Brazil, the process for parents to obtain citizenship is generally faster and simpler (less than 3 years) compared to Chile. Santiago, Chile is considered a good city.

riskRussian citizens with a residence permit (VNJ) living abroad should avoid military registration in Russia.
To renew or obtain an internal passport (e.g., at 20 years old), one must be removed from military records. A consular certificate confirming foreign residency is required. Legal consultation is advised if difficulties arise.

ruleEcuador is presented as a relatively easy option for obtaining citizenship without requiring marriage or significant investment.
A bachelor's degree (full-time) can grant a 2-year temporary residency, renewable. Naturalization requires a Spanish language exam. While the passport may not be as strong as others, it's considered a feasible option with moderate effort and investment.
